Black silicon carbide (SiC) is a synthetic mineral produced in a high-temperature electric resistance furnace from quartz sand and petroleum coke. Its hexagonal crystal structure gives it outstanding physical properties, making it an ideal choice for abrasive tools, refractory materials, and metallurgical applications. Key Features

  • Outstanding Hardness: With a Mohs hardness of 9.2, black SiC offers excellent cutting efficiency and durability.
  • Superior Thermal Conductivity: Effectively dissipates heat during high-speed grinding and cutting processes.
  • Sharp, Angular Morphology: It promotes aggressive material removal and clean surface finishes.
  • High Chemical and Oxidation Resistance: It maintains stability and performance under harsh operating conditions.

Macro Grains (HG-AB093)

Our FEPA-compliant macro grains are ideal for:

  • Resinoid Bonded Grinding Wheels: Used in metal fabrication, tool sharpening, and foundry applications.
  • Cut-off and Snagging Wheels: Suitable for high-speed cutting of steel and cast iron.
  • Anti-slip Flooring: It provides enhanced traction and abrasion resistance for industrial and architectural surfaces.

Micro Grains (HG-AB094)

Finely processed micro grains are widely used for:

  • Stone Polishing: Ideal for finishing marble, granite, and engineered stone with high gloss and minimal surface damage.
  • Lapping and Surface Finishing: It enables precision polishing in optical, electronic, and tooling industries.
